你好我是数据记录器编程新手。我将在现场使用一些LP02日射强度计和CR10x数据记录器。我希望操作员能够按住触发器或拨动开关打开传感器,进行一些测量,并将数据记录到内存中。这可能吗?如果是,怎么做?我看到的所有示例程序都会每隔一段时间使用测量值。
谢谢
埃文
埃文-
这里有一种方法:
(1) 无论是否存储测量值,都要定期读取传感器。
(2) 在5V端子和C端子(例如C1)之间连接一个常开开关
(3) 在您的程序中,使用说明25读取C1端口的状态。
(4) 在程序中设置一个If/Then/Else块,如果C1为高,则将Flag 0设置为高;如果C1为低,则将标志0设置为低。
(5) 使用指令77(存储时间)和指令70(存储最新测量值)。这两条指令,就像所有输出指令(#69-82)一样,只在标志0为高时存储到内存中。因此,在这种情况下,当开关闭合时,您将存储时间和瞬时日射强度计测量值。
-格雷格